Sabbath

McConkie  The Promised Messiah p 390-391
“Sabbath worship, that system which singles out one day in seven to be used exclusively for spiritual things, is a sign which identifies the Lord’s people. ...True religion always has and always will call for a Sabbath on which men rest from their temporal labors and work exclusively on spiritual matters.  True religion requires-it is not optional; it is mandatory-that one in seven be devoted exclusively to worshiping the Father in Spirit and in truth.  Without a Sabbath of rest and worship, men’s hearts will never be centered on the things of the Spirit sufficiently to assure them of salvation....It is in no sense an exaggeration nor does it overstate the fact one whit to say that any person who keeps the Sabbath, according to the revealed pattern, will be saved in the celestial kingdom.”
